It’s been a fairly tumultuous season for Charlton this year as Lee Bowyer has had to contend with a whole host of problems at the club due to the horrific underfunding of club owner, Roland Duchâtelet.
The fans have been incredibly dissatisfied with how the how the Belgian owner has run the club and considering some of the news that had come out of Chartlon, it’s not hard to understand why.
Promised staff bonuses have not been paid, academy players have not been allowed water and a rumoured takeover from an Australian consortium is yet to come to fruition.
Within the off-field turmoil at the club, after their recent win over Bristol Rovers, Charlton remain in the hunt for the playoffs and currently sit sixth in the table.
At the beginning of the season, Charlton lost their best player in Jake Forster-Caskey to add more to woe to their season but in his stead, young striker Karlan Grant has stepped up to fill his shoes.
A product of the youth academy, the 21-year-old has been a star for the side this season and has scored nine goals in 18 games while also recording four assists.
The striker has been in around the first-team for the last three years but as of yet has never been a consistent goalscoring force for the club.
Last year he was sent on loan to Crawley Town in league Two where he had an impressive spell and scored nine goals in 15 games.
He’s taken that solid form into this season and thanks to him and Lyle Taylor, Charlton have managed to keep themselves above water.
Unfortunately for Bowyer, the forward’s contract runs out next year and has yet to sign a new deal. Considering the turmoil at the club at the moment and Grant’s superb form, the young striker should look to make a move away from the club in the summer.
